

Mariano “Naning” C. Torino, a loving husband, father, and grandfather, passed away on February 18, 2018 in Santa Clara, California. He was 91 years old.
Mariano was born on February 2, 1927 in Batangas, Philippines to his parents Bartolome and Isabel Torino. He graduated from Batangas High School and received his Bachelor of Science degree in Accounting from the University of the East in Manila, Philippines. Mariano married Lily G. Purugganan on July 18, 1964. He worked as an Examiner for the Bureau of Internal Revenue and as an Internal Auditor for the Filipinas Cement Corporation. Mariano migrated to the United States of America in 1976, lived in Los Angeles, California, and worked for the Department of Health Services. His family followed in 1980 and settled in Baldwin Park, California. The family later moved to Santa Clara, California as Mariano transferred to the San Jose, California branch of the Department of Health Services.
Mariano is survived by his wife Lily, daughter and son-in-law Maria and Brian Chiang, son and daughter-in-law Raymon and Anne Torino, daughter Jasmin Torino, and grandchildren Megan Chiang, Rayanne Torino, and Ryan Torino.
